OVERVIEW

Get analog inputs and outputs that are compliant with the SMPTE standard.

The Pulse 16 is the high-quality solution to connect and route a wide range of Analog, MADI, ADAT and Dante equipment, with up to 192 kHz. The high-density converter provides 16 x 16 balanced analog TRS-I/Os and can handle pro studio levels up to +20dBu, adjustable in 1 dB steps. Optional +24 dBU I/Os and/or CV outputs are available. Combined with a temperature-compensated high-precision clock and an active jitter reduction hardware design, the 354-channel DX delivers an exceptional detailed sound. On the digital side, the multi-format device provides an optical MADI I/O with 64 I/Os. 2 x 4 ADAT ports can convert all 16 analog I/Os, even with up to 96 kHz. On top of it, the DX adds 64 x 64 channels of Dante/AES67 to an already impressive array of various I/Os, unique in this size and price range. The Pulse 16 incorporates a Word Clock I/O and a MIDI I/O for embedding signals and remote control of the unit. Many popular features from the flagship A32 have been added as well: Preset Management, Panel Lock and the sophisticated routing matrix. This fan-less, small footprint device is a huge problem solver for studio and live sound applications. This optional version raises the maximum input and output level of the 16 analog inputs and outputs from +20dBu to +24dBu, which then complies with the SMPTE standard.

SPECIFICATIONS
ADAT I/O
  • TOSlink optical: 2 x 4
  • 32 Channel I/O: At 32kHz, 44.1kHz, 48kHz
  • 16 Channels: At 64kHz, 88.2kHz, 96kHz
  • 8 Channels: At 128kHz, 176.4kHz, 192kHz
  • Latency: 2 samples
MADI I/O
  • SFP cage: For MADI single-mode or optional multimode SFP module
  • 64 Channel I/O: At 32kHz, 44.1kHz, 48kHz
  • 32 Channels: At 64kHz, 88.2kHz, 96kHz
  • 16 Channels: At 128kHz, 176kHz, 192kHz
  • Latency: 3 samples
  • MIDI-over-MADI: Implemented
Dante Network I/O (redundant)
  • RJ45 network ports: 2
  • 64 Channel I/O: At 32kHz, 44.1kHz, 48kHz
  • 32 Channels: At 64kHz, 88.2kHz, 96kHz
  • 16 Channels: At 128kHz, 176.4kHz, 192kHz
  • MIDI-over-Dante: Implemented
